Tourism Development Fund Signs Financing Agreement with Shada Development Company for new hotel
Saudi Arabia’s Tourism Development Fund (TDF) announced today the signing of a financing agreement with Shada Real Estate Development and Investment Company. The agreement is to establish a 4-star boutique hotel featuring 110 hotel rooms in Jeddah, one of the targeted tourist destinations. The hotel will be designed with a mix of the architectural styles of Makkah region and the local style.

The Hoxton makes Germany debut with Berlin hotel
The Hoxton has swung open its doors in Charlottenburg, bringing the brand to Berlin and marking its German debut. Set just steps away from the renowned shopping avenue, Ku’damm, the Hoxton, Charlottenburg offers 234 rooms.
